Empower HV Ltd. is seeking a full-time HV Electrical Fitter to work in a remote capacity across the UK. This role involves the installation, testing, and maintenance of high-voltage electrical equipment.
The ideal candidate should possess:
- Strong electrical maintenance skills
- Proficiency in wiring techniques
- The ability to interpret technical drawings
A commitment to health and safety in high-voltage environments is essential. Previous experience in high-voltage roles is an advantage.
